Table 2.

Summary of Animal Models for the Study of Preeclampsia and Associated Offspring Phenotypea

Model General findings Offspring neurobiology Refs
AVP infusion in mice Dams: gestation-specific hypertension, renal dysfunction, proteinuria; ↑ interferon (IFN)g, IL-17; ↓ IL-4, IL-10
Placentas: ↓ PlGF, altered morphology, blood flow, oxidative stress, and immune dysregulation; ↑ IL-17
Fetuses: growth restriction; ↑ IL-17; ↓ IL-4, IL-10
n/a [40,89]
IL-17 manipulation in rats Dams: hypertension, oxidative stress; ↑ IL-6, TNFα, IL-17
Placentas: oxidative stress
n/a [96,97]
L-NAME treatment in rats Dams: hypertension, renal dysfunction, proteinuria, oxidative stress; angiogenic dysfunction; stillbirths
Placentas: inflammation, structural changes
Fetuses: growth restriction
↓ Neonatal brain weight, neurogenesis; ↑ adult gliogenesis; ↓ learning, memory, hippocampal neurogenesis and glucocorticoid receptor expression; neonatal and adult brain ↑ microglial protein, and ↓ glial glutamate transporter protein [62b,99,100b,102b,117]
PlGF deficiency in mice Impaired adult angiogenesis and revascularization, abnormal vascular permeability/growth, and inflammation Impaired memory, locomotor, anxiety- and depressive-like behavior; ↓ regional brain volumes; cerebral blood vessel changes [69b,70b,105b,106]
RUPP in rats Dams: hypertension, ↑ sFlt-1, renal dysfunction, proteinuria, oxidative stress; ↑ cortical water; neuroinflammation; altered astrocyte, microglia numbers; ↓ litter size Placentas: hypoxia, inflammation, oxidative stress
Fetuses: ↑ hematocrit
↓ fetal brain microglia, ↑ cerebral micro-bleeds, neuroinflammation; cortical thickness unchanged [52b,76,77,91,114116,118]
Angiogenic dysregulation and systemic inflammation in mice Dams: hypertension and albuminuria
Fetuses: growth restriction; altered metabolism
n/a [61]
Impaired umbilical circulation in sheep Fetuses: ↑ hypoxemia In fetal cortex: gliosis, myelination, neuronal process defects; white matter lesions; abnormal cerebrovasculature; ↓ Purkinje neurons [78]
